2016-12-12 3 views
0

Я не могу удалить ось Y после этого: chart.yAxis[i].setExtremes(0, 100);. Мне нужно иметь возможность устанавливать максимальные и минимальные значения для оси динамически, основываясь на индексе yAxis - в этом случае я пропускаю 1. Все остальные оси исчезают отлично, потому что эта строка кода не влияет на них. Что происходит ? Fiddle (нажмите «Осадки в легенде»): http://jsfiddle.net/ytxetjpL/Ось Y не исчезает после установки крайностей

ответ

0

Ось скрыта, когда масштаб не установлен (через min/max или setExtremes). Более подробную информацию можно получить здесь: github.

Это дополнение должно решить проблему.

Highcharts.Axis.prototype.hasData = function() { 
    return this.hasVisibleSeries; 
}; 

пример: http://jsfiddle.net/ytxetjpL/1/